jjb: babeltrace: use clang-format-16
[lttng-ci.git] / jobs / lttng-modules.yaml
index ed98b73c96fda7571ceed65523615f24d35b72b3..f5ce833751af6c44ef8a49e44a1f641840f0f8bf 100644 (file)
@@ -91,7 +91,7 @@
           description: 'Kernel versions list filtering strategy.'
       - string:
           name: 'kverrc'
-          default: 'true'
+          default: '{kverrc|true}'
           description: 'Add latest RC to kernel versions list.'
       - string:
           name: 'kgitrepo'
           description: 'Kernel versions list filtering strategy.'
       - string:
           name: 'kverrc'
-          default: 'true'
+          default: '{kverrc|true}'
           description: 'Add latest RC to kernel versions list.'
       - string:
           name: 'kgitrepo'
       - string:
           name: 'mversion'
           default: 'master'
-          description: 'The lttng-modules branch to build.'
+          description: 'The lttng-modules branch to build. Use `refs/XXX` for a specific ref, or a commit hash.'
       - string:
           name: 'mgitrepo'
           default: 'git://git-mirror.internal.efficios.com/lttng/lttng-modules.git'
           name: 'getsrc_version'
           default: 'main'
           description: 'The tag or commit to use when cloning the getsrc tool'
+      - bool:
+          name: 'DEBUG'
+          default: false
+          description: "Enable verbose builds"
+      - bool:
+          name: 'FAIL_ON_WARNINGS'
+          default: false
+          description: "Fail the lttng-modules build if there are any warnings"
 
     concurrent: true
 
           kverfloor: v3.0
           kverceil: v5.18-rc1
           kverfilter: stable-head
+          kverrc: false
       - 'lttng-modules_{mversion}_fullbuild-vanilla':
           mversion:
             - stable-2.12
           kverfloor: v3.0
           kverceil: v5.18-rc1
           kverfilter: none
+          kverrc: false
 
 # EL normal builds
       - 'lttng-modules_{mversion}_{buildtype}-{elversion}':
           kverfloor: v3.18
           kverceil: v5.18-rc1
           kverfilter: stable-head
+          kverrc: false
 
 # Ubuntu cross builds
       - 'lttng-modules_{mversion}_{buildtype}-{uversion}':
           kverfloor: v3.0
           kverceil: v5.18
           kverfilter: lts-head
+          kverrc: false
       - 'dev_review_lttng-modules_{mversion}_build-{elversion}':
           mversion:
             - master
This page took 0.029224 seconds and 4 git commands to generate.